The Are Air Dehydrated Canine Diet & Are It's Suitable For Your Pup? Air-dried puppy nutrition is a fascinating approach to traditional canned and raw diets, presenting a different way of retaining nutrients. The process involves slowly removing moisture from ingredients – typically carefully selected meats, vegetables, and produce – at low heat levels over an extended timeframe. This gentle technique works to lessen breakdown, keeping the natural aromas and important content. So, does this style of diet appropriate for every canine? Ultimately, the answer depends on his/her puppy’s unique requirements, age, and certain current medical conditions. Think about consulting with a veterinarian prior to making a significant dietary changes.
